Verdict
Qwen3 Coder Flash (OpenRouter) has the cheaper input rate, while Codestral 2501 has the cheaper output rate. The crossover happens when output makes up about 58% of your total tokens.
Below that share (retrieval, summarization, extraction — lots of context in, little text out) Qwen3 Coder Flash (OpenRouter) is cheaper. Above it (generation, translation, coding — long completions) Codestral 2501 wins.
